Understanding API Service Discovery
What is API Service Discovery?
API Service Discovery is the process of discovering and accessing available APIs within a distributed system. It enables developers to dynamically find and interact with services without needing to know their specific locations or configurations. This is particularly useful in microservices architectures, where services are often deployed across multiple servers and may change over time.
Key Components of API Service Discovery
- Service Registry: A central repository that stores information about available services, including their endpoints, metadata, and status.
- Discovery Service: A component that queries the service registry to find and retrieve information about available services.
- Service Consumers: Applications that consume services and use the discovery service to locate and interact with them.
Why is API Service Discovery Important?
- Scalability: As the number of services grows, manual management becomes impractical. API Service Discovery allows for automatic scaling and deployment.
- Flexibility: Services can be added, updated, or removed without disrupting the overall system.
- Resilience: In case of a service failure, the discovery service can direct requests to alternative services, ensuring high availability.
Challenges in API Service Discovery
- Complexity: Implementing and managing a service discovery system can be complex, especially in large-scale distributed systems.
- Consistency: Ensuring that all services are correctly registered and updated in the service registry can be challenging.
- Security: Discovering and accessing services securely without exposing sensitive information is critical.

The Role of API Gateways
API gateways are an essential component of modern API architectures. They provide a single entry point for all API requests, enabling them to route requests to the appropriate backend service, authenticate users, and enforce policies.
Benefits of API Gateways
- Security: API gateways can enforce security policies, such as authentication and authorization, to protect APIs.
- Throttling and Rate Limiting: API gateways can limit the number of requests per user or IP address, preventing abuse and ensuring fair usage.
- Monitoring and Analytics: API gateways can collect and analyze API usage data, providing insights into usage patterns and performance issues.
